Web3. Filter grouping. In addition to being able to group data with GROUP BY, SQL also allows filtering groups, specifying which groups to include and which groups to exclude. For … WebAug 27, 2024 · Grouping results is a powerful SQL feature that allows you to compute key statistics for a group of records. GROUP BY is one of SQL’s most powerful clauses. It …
Did you know?
WebJul 21, 2024 · SQL GROUP BY is most often used in combination with aggregate functions like COUNT (), MAX (), MIN (), SUM (), and AVG () .It groups the result set by one or more columns, essentially creating summary rows for each group. These groups are usually based on categorical rather than continuous values. For example, if you are using a dataset of ... WebSep 30, 2024 · GROUPING은 집계데이터와 NULL을 구분해 주는 것이 아닌, ROLLUP, CUBE, GROUPING_SETS 함수가 말아준 총 값 (소계,집계)인지 아닌지를 이분법적으로 구분해주는 …
Web1 day ago · 2 Answers. One option is to look at the problem as if it were gaps and islands, i.e. put certain rows into groups (islands) and then extract data you need. SQL> with test (type, fr_date, to_date, income) as 2 (select 'A', date '2024-04-14', date '2024-04-14', 100 from dual union all 3 select 'A', date '2024-04-15', date '2024-04-16', 200 from ... WebSQL GROUP BY Statement. Data Grouping and Data Aggregation are the important concepts of SQL. There are circumstances where we need to apply aggregate function not only to a single set of rows, but also to a group of rows that have the same values, so in such a situation, the SQL GROUP BY statement is used with SQL SELECT statement.
WebJun 28, 2024 · Structured Query Language — commonly known as SQL — is a language used to define, control, manipulate, and query data held in a relational database. SQL has been … WebThe SQL Grouping_ID () is the SQL function which is used to compute the level of grouping. It can only be used with SELECT statement, HAVING clause, or ORDERED BY clause when GROUP BY is specified. The GROUPING_ID () function returns an integer bitmap with the lowest N bits illuminated. A illuminated bit indicates that the corresponding ...
WebThe GROUP BY statement is often used with aggregate functions ( COUNT (), MAX (), MIN (), SUM (), AVG ()) to group the result-set by one or more columns. GROUP BY Syntax …
WebYou can use GROUPING SETS, ROLLUP, and CUBE clauses of the GROUP BY clause in subselect queries. The following examples illustrate the use of GROUPING SETS, ROLLUP, and CUBE clauses of the GROUP BY clause in subselect queries. The queries in Examples 1 - 4 use a subset of the rows in the SALES tables based on the predicate 'WEEK … how to mod mc dungeons on xboxWebClick "Run SQL" to execute the SQL statement above. W3Schools has created an SQL database in your browser. The menu to the right displays the database, and will reflect any changes. Feel free to experiment with any SQL statement. You can restore the database at … multy edge carpet tapeWeb1 Answer. Sorted by: 6. SELECT Country, City, COUNT (*) AS [Count] FROM CountriesAndCities GROUP BY GROUPING SETS ( ( Country, City ), ( Country) ) HAVING GROUPING (City) = 0 OR COUNT (DISTINCT City) > 1 ORDER BY Country, City. GROUPING (City) = 0 if City one of the fields currently being grouped by. Conversely, when GROUPING … how to mod melee using dolphinWebJul 9, 2024 · The GROUPING and GROUPING_ID functions are used to identify whether the columns in the GROUP BY list are aggregated (using the ROLLUP or CUBE operators) or not. There are two major differences between the GROUPING and … multy foam abeeWebGROUPING distinguishes superaggregate rows from regular grouped rows. GROUP BY extensions such as ROLLUP and CUBE produce superaggregate rows where the set of all values is represented by null. Using the GROUPING function, you can distinguish a null representing the set of all values in a superaggregate row from a null in a regular row. how to mod medieval 2 total warWebJun 18, 2024 · GROUPING SETS are groups, or sets, of columns by which rows can be grouped together. Instead of writing multiple queries and combining the results with a UNION, you can simply use GROUPING... multy edge carpet finishing tapeWebFeb 28, 2024 · The GROUP BY clause supports all GROUP BY features that are included in the SQL-2006 standard with the following syntax exceptions: Grouping sets aren't allowed … multy epdm roofing trade